Tyler Perry Studios in Atlanta with Will Smith and Oprah Winfrey

Tyler Perry was due to leave Atlanta after a number of residents had complained about the noise from his studio. It is now reported that there is a new Tyler Perry Studios in Atlanta, the new movie and TV studio was attended by a star studded guest list.

Those A-list stars that attended the opening were Will Smith, Oprah Winfrey and Forest Whitaker; other stars included Sidney Poitier, Hank Aaron and Whitney Houston. Mary J Blige was on hand to entertain with a few of her R&B hits.

The new Atlanta Tyler Perry Studios has over 200,000 square feet of studio and office space. Perry has said that he will be shooting his hit sitcoms “House of Payne” and “Meet the Browns” at the new studio.
